Enhance precision in pressure measurement with our XDCR MS1S1-00000J-250PG Industrial Pressure Transducer. Designed for gage pressure applications, this sensor ensures accurate readings with a ±0.5% span. Operating efficiently in temperatures ranging from 0 to 55°C (32 to 131°F), it is ideal for diverse industrial environments. With a supply voltage of 2.7 to 5V and output through a 14-bit ADC SPI, it offers reliable performance. The port fitting features an O-Ring Face Seal for secure installation. This RoHS-compliant sensor is a crucial component for monitoring pressure in HVAC systems and various industrial processes. Product Category:
Manufacturer: TE Connectivity | Sensors
Manufacturer Part Number: MS1S1-00000J-250PG
Accuracy: ±.5 % Span
Sensor Type: Industrial Pressure Transducer
Operating Temperature Range: 0 - 55 °C, 32 - 131 °F
Supply Voltage: 2.7 - 5 V
Port Fitting: O-Ring Face Seal
Output: 14-bit ADC SPI
Operating Pressure: 250 psi
Pressure Type: Gage
SKU: TSS10201889-00
series: MEAS MSP100
Port Material: 316L
Electrical Connection: Cable 2 ft
Dimensions: 12.7 x 24.38 x 20.32 mm / .5 x .96 x .8 in
Proof Pressure Range: 1.5X Rated
Options: Without Sleep Mode
